Ethanol Free Standing Fireplace

Free standing bio-ethanol fireplaces add a touch of elegance to any room. They are simple to set up and don't require chimneys. However, it is essential to ensure they are protected from wind and rain.

Bioethanol fuel is produced from agricultural waste products such as sugarcane or corn. It burns cleanly and emits only water vapor and a small amount of carbon dioxide, similar to the way humans exhale.

The process of installing a recessed ethanol fireplace may differ from one brand to the next however, there are generally 5 steps.  freestanding bioethanol fireplaces  is to determine the size of the fireplace as well as the opening in the wall. You can refer to the product manual to find out the specific dimensions, but in general you'll need to cut an opening that is 4" wider and 2 1/2 " higher than the fireplace. Make sure the ethanol fireplace does not block windows or doors.

After you have decided the size of the opening, you'll need to build walls around it. You can build them using plywood or drywall, but it is best to use plywood. You can then paint or tile the walls to give them a more finished appearance.

It is safe to make use of

Ethanol fireplaces offer a safe alternative to wood-burning fireplaces. They don't produce smoke or ash nor soot. They also require very little maintenance. They are also easy to set up and have a small footprint, making them an ideal choice for homes that do not have chimneys. It is essential to keep in mind that ethanol fireplaces aren't very efficient and should only be used as a backup source of heat.

Ethanol fires burn cleanly and produce only water vapor and little carbon dioxide. They don't require a chimney or vent and can be set up in any space. In addition, they are easy to extinguish, and most models have built-in mechanisms that safely cuts off oxygen to the flames. This makes them a good option for homes with children or pets.

While ethanol fireplaces can appear like a safe alternative to traditional wood or gas-burning fireplaces, they still present risks if they are not properly operated or installed. The risk is increased when the fireplace is located near flammable surfaces or materials like curtains and carpets. The risk can be minimized by following the instructions for installation and usage provided by the manufacturer.

The majority of ethanol burners come with safety sensors that prevent overheating or fires. These features can prevent accidental spills of ethanol, and ensure that the fireplace is safe to operate. In addition these safety features can be enhanced with additional safety measures, such as keeping the fireplace away from flammable surfaces and making sure that the fireplace isn't burning too much smoke or overheating.
